What change occurs in a muscle during an eccentric contraction

Respuesta :

amirthaa
amirthaa amirthaa
  • 21-12-2020

Answer:

During an eccentric contraction, when an active muscle, fiber or myofibril is actively stretched, its force increases substantially during the stretch.
